BRAUN, HOGENBERG, BLAEU, HONDIUS, ALLARD, OTTENS, AND OTHERS, A COLLECTION OF 21 MAPS OF RUSSIA, [1563-C.1785]

- A collection of 21 engraved maps on 23 sheets. [1563-c.1785]
Herberstein, Sigismund. Andere Landtaffel: In welcher der Moscoviten gebuet mit sampt den welden und bergen, auch etlichen gebreüchen unnd allen umligenden Landschafften begriffen. [1563], hand-coloured, slightly cropped with minor repairs; Braun, Georg and Frans Hogenberg. Mons Regius; Prussiae, Sive Borussiae, Urbs Maritima, Elegantissima Princips Sedes. [c.1581], Latin text to verso, hand-coloured, only top view (lacking the view of Riga), remargined at foot, strengthened at verso; Quad, Matthias. Moscoviae Imperium. 1600, Latin text to verso, [Dr. Hans-Peter Kosack, ink stamp to verso]; Hondius, Henricus. Novissima Russiae Tabula Authore Isaaco Massa. [1635], hand-coloured, Latin text to verso, minor marginal tears; Blaeu, Joan. Tractvs Borysthenis, vulgo Dniepr et Niepr dicti, a Civitate Czyrkassi. [1662], hand-coloured, Latin text to verso, 2 copies; Blaeu, Joan. Tractus Borysthenis vulgo Dniepr et Niepr dicti, à Kiovia usque ad Bouzin. [1662], hand-coloured, Latin text to verso; Blaeu, Joan. Tractus Borysthenis vulgo Dniepr et Niepr dicti, a Chortika Ostro ad Urbem Oczakow. [1662], hand-coloured, Latin text to verso; Blaeu, Joan. Tractus Borysthenis vulgo Dniepr et Niepr dicti, ad Bouzin usque as Chortyca Ostrow. [1662], hand-coloured, Latin text to verso; Blaeu, Joan. Dwina Fluvius. [1662], hand-coloured, Latin text to verso; Moscoviae Pars Australis Auctore Isaaco Massa. [1680?], hand-coloured, without gridlines, and with elaborate armorial shield, Latin text to verso, minor browning, repair to lower margin; Allard, Carel. Tartaria, sive Magni Chami Imperium. [c.1700], hand-coloured; Ides, Evert Isbrand. Nova Tabula Imperii Russici. [c.1704], engraved by Droogenham , minor marginal tears; Ottens, Joshua. Nova ac Verissima Maris Caspii. [1723], engraved and hand-coloured; Homann, Johann Baptist. Principatus Transilvaniae in suas quasque nations. [c.1720], hand-coloured; Delisle, Guillaume. Carte Marine de la Mer Caspiene. Reinier Ottens, 1723, large engraved map on 2 sheets, hand-coloured, mounted separately in passepartout; Aa, Pieter van der and Nicolaas Witsen. Novogorod, ville de la Moscovie. [1729], engraved city view, left side repaired and backed with thin paper; Ottens, Reinier and Joshua. Pontus Euxinus of Niewe en naaukeurige Paskaart van de Zwarte Zee. [1745], hand-coloured, mounted in passepartout, reinforced on verso of centre-fold; Covens, Jean and Corneille Mortier. Carte Generale de L’Empire de Russie. 1748, engraved map of Russia on 2 sheets, hand-coloured in outline, minor tears to centrefolds; De Leth, Hendrick and Pierre Schenk. Carte de la Petite Tartarie dressée par ordre de l'impératrice de toutes les Russies. [c.1785], rare engraved battle plan, hand-coloured; [Engraved view of Insterburg [Chernyakhovsk] and surroundings], hand-coloured. Sold a collection not subject to return
